Security Posture Analysis
Comprehensive Security Assessment
The website uses HTTPS, which is a positive security indicator. However, it lacks important security headers such as Content-Security-Policy, X-Frame-Options, and HSTS, which are recommended to mitigate common web vulnerabilities. The contact form includes a simple captcha to reduce spam but no advanced security or incident response information is provided. No vulnerability disclosure or security policies are present, indicating a low maturity level in security governance. The absence of analytics and tracking reduces privacy risks but also limits insight into user behavior. Overall, the security posture is basic and could be improved with standard best practices.
